The Need For Education
The decline of defined pension plans and the uncertain future of Social Security means that most Americans must shoulder the responsibility for their own retirement savings.  Yet most individuals are woefully unprepared:
  • Only 15% of baby boomers are confident of maintaining their pre-retirement standard of living.*
  • More than one-third of Generation X workers (ages 26 to 41) and about two-thirds of Generation Y (age 18 to 25) fail to save in their employer-sponsored retirement plans.*
